The only "anti-bunkering" function is that the project is no long announced in advance. There is nothing else that can be done about Members/Teams "speculating" as to which project might be chosen - and I doubt that the project admin would make any announcement BEFORE the start time.
However, efforts are made (in advance) to ensure that the selected Sprint project will have enough tasks available, but some Members/Teams could easily have enough hosts to be crunching a few projects and once the announcement is made, they can easily stop accepting tasks from other projects.
